Can the vacant units held available for qualified tenants be counted toward the number of units needed to meet the propertys set-asides?

0

No, only Qualifying Units can be counted toward a property’s Set-Asides, and units may not be designated as Qualifying Units until they are occupied by a qualified tenant.
